Output 6dd72f529a9067742c4f4b8d94507eb5c08ac8d933d485fcbccaab36b23f7634:1

value
725660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b66dc6a3989c7b6808fa6d8c027cb98c1a683cbf OP_EQUALVERIFY OP_CHECKSIG
address
1HdbVHAexyomaZVYw5bNP1N7gR9svxv4xg
transaction
6dd72f529a9067742c4f4b8d94507eb5c08ac8d933d485fcbccaab36b23f7634
spent
true